Job Description

SUNY Maritime College Location: Bronx, NY Category: Administrative & Professional Posted On: Mon Mar 2 2026 Job Description: Perform all required Watchstanding, maintenance and repair of ship's systems as assigned by the Chief Engineer, but specifically Electrical and Electronic systems in general and specifically High Voltage generation and propulsion aboard the current TS Empire State Operate and maintain High Voltage Systems and associated control and automation systems Operate, manage and perform assigned duties of a Maintenance Work Order System Operate, manage and perform assigned duties of a Safety Management System Teaching up to three courses in the Engine license curriculum each year (but no more than 9 credits) depending on the ship's operational schedule and at the discretion of the Chief Engineer Participation on Summer Sea Term would be required for at least one half of the SST (Cruise A or Cruise B) with duties to include training and development of cadets onboard the ship during SST by a subject matter expert capable of mentoring 500 cadets A direct advisor and mentor to engineering cadets in the engine license program Advise the Indoctrination Program and works with Cadet IDO leadership to develop MUG engineering training programs during the academic semesters Model appropriate character and strong ethics through disciplined behavior and professional appearance, as a representative of SUNY Maritime College. The position entails the daily shaping of the future leaders of global industries and the military, including those specializing in the Maritime profession, and the transportation and business sectors. As such this position requires the individual to maintain the highest standards of conduct and appearance, as well as actively leading and managing the development and maturation of the license cadets Support the cooperation between the ship, the regiment, academia and professional development programs When necessary, assist the TSES Engine Dept with the Dean of Admissions to recruit potential students including Open Houses and other events to showcase the College and in particular the engine training program on the ship Job Requirements: Required Qualifications: Bachelor's degree or 10 years of Industry Experience that includes High Voltage or HV Propulsion Active minimum grade USCG issued 2 A/E's MMC with STCW endorsement and at least 5 years sailing experience Transportation Worker's Identification (TWIC) and passport for international travel Experience in education, state, or large city system Current STCW compliant MMC Medical Certificate Valid driver license free of major or repeated violations Excellent interpersonal and problem solving skills Demonstrated leadership skills Demonstrate organizational skills Ability to prioritize and accomplish multiple tasks Excellent oral and written communication skills Strong desire to work in a student-oriented environment in higher educationPreferred Qualifications: Master's degree Military experience Additional Information: Classification/Salary Range: The Second Assistant Engineer is a UUP position. The anticipated salary range for the position is $95,000 to $105,000 annually, with an outstanding benefits package. For more information please see the UUP-FT-Benefits-at-a-Glance-Jan-2025.pdf. Review of applications to commence immediately and conclude when the position is filled.Special Notes: This is a full-time calendar year (12 month) appointment UUP Position. Fair Labor Standard Acts (FLSA) Exempt position, not eligible for the overtime provisions of the FLSA. Internal and external search to occur simultaneously.
